High Permeability Insulation Functional Double-layer Glass

Functional glass with an insulating air layer while improving the transmittance decrease, which is a weakness of double-layer glass
Applicable Field
  • Clothing store windows: improved visibility of internal images and energy savings by reflection
  • Building exterior wall glass : Improved visible light transmittance and energy savings
  • Solar cell : Increased power generation efficiency by improving light transmittance
Advantages of Anti-reflection Insulating Air Layer Glass
  • Improvement of light transmittance by anti-reflection : Improvement of internal image visibility and energy-saving effect by reflection of clothing store and building windows
  • Insulation layer made of hollow silica : The air layer that is shielded inside the hollow particles has very limited movement, so there is no movement such as convection, so it has the effect of blocking heat and noise.

Measurement of Optical Properties of Anti-reflection Glass

Existing double-layer glass

Double-layer glass with anti-reflection coating

Anti-reflection double-layer glass light transmittance

Transmittance Improvement Measurement Results
Transmittance Improvement Measurement Results
Existing double-layer glass Anti-reflection coated glass Transmittance improvement
Transmittance average(300nm~800nm) 84.6 % 89.4 % ¡è4.8 %
Transmittance 550nm(Visible Light Center Wave) 85.3 % 90.8 % ¡è5.5 %
